His sisters were renowned beauties far and wide, so Wang Zhengjun naturally had high standards. Handsome, articulate, educated, and refined, he piqued the interest of the daughters of landlords and young women from the town alike. However, he believed in his own dignity and didn’t need to "marry up". The idea of the woman being wealthier than him was nothing more than an attempt to imitate a reversed process of climbing the social ladder – something he considered distasteful. Furthermore, he didn’t find those young women to be anything special, nowhere as charming as his sisters. So, he turned them down, righteously.

Once news of his refusal spread, it earned him the label of being "dignified". So boosted was his ego he almost seemed to strut around with his tail pointed straight to the sky.

With her fair skin, large eyes, and slender physique, Liu Jinhua somehow managed to catch Wang Zhengjun’s eye.

Liu Jinhua was very smart and calculated. Wang Zhenguo never considered her as a potential sister-in-law, however she managed to charm Wang Zhengjun. Seeing as she had no siblings, one thing led to another and Wang Zhengjun became smitten, declaring he would marry no other.

When Wang Zhengjun and Liu Jinhua got married, Liu Jinhua practically brought her entire dowry from home.

She had promised her parents that she would take care of them in their old age after marrying Wang Zhenguo.

The two villages were close by, and considering the Wang family’s many brothers, one more or one less made little difference.

The Liu family only had one daughter, and they were afraid there would be no one to care for them in their old age. They believed her and gave her all their five acre field and savings as a dowry. Who knew that just as Liu Jinhua stepped out of their home, her mother fell pregnant and at the age of forty shockingly gave birth to a boy.

Having a son and not having a son made a world of difference, so the old man Liu wanted his five-acre field back.

Now he had a son and needed to plan for the future.

Liu Jinhua was unwilling, stating that a dowry, like a married daughter, is not something to be returned. This left old man Liu sick with rage and he nearly died of it.

Unfair as it was, the Liu family became a landless farming family after the establishment of the People’s Republic of China and their social status became the highest. Liu Jinhua’s dowry field was nationalized. Had it not been just a five-acre field, and social status not tied to the father, the couple might have been classified as poor farmers or middle peasants, who were considered landowners if they labored and did not exploit others.

Before long, the city’s coal mines started hiring. Then-village head Wang Zhenguo got a few quotas to allocate to the village’s young labor force, but in the end, only Wang Zhengjun was chosen. The reason was simple: he was literate, sweet-tongued, and handsome, so he was quickly selected.

While Wang Zhengjun gained a city resident’s household registration, Liu Jinhua and their child remained rural residents.

While Wang Zhengjun had access to rationed food, Liu Jinhua had to farm and earn work points for food. Wang Zhenguo was impartial in his distribution; if you didn’t work and earn work points, you didn’t get food. For a few years, the relationship between the two brothers was not very good.

Later, Wang Zhengjun managed to get Liu Jinhua and the child to the city. For the first couple of years, Liu Jinhua had to come back, work to earn work points, and bring some food back. After a couple of years, she stopped coming back. Apparently, they had settled their household registration and were receiving rationed food. Except for the time Wang Jiao got married and Wang Zhengjun came back, in the last five or six years, they hadn’t been seen at all.

Now Wang Zhengjun appeared again, asking for several hundred kilograms of grain. Honestly, Wang Zhenguo was quite shocked.
